Transaction 581c8a81ca99e122f27ee4a37ebed1421eeea803606aa4244e16cc65a50dbf78
1 Input
1 Output
-
581c8a81ca99e122f27ee4a37ebed1421eeea803606aa4244e16cc65a50dbf78:0
- value
- 2204715
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 75eeab5504fd5f56640d609bac6c9051db520c11 OP_EQUAL
- address
- 3CSau24yAxi3Mqrekj4dqMyTPGRpYnHZ8K